Quarterly EBITDA growth indicates an increase in ear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ortisation, providing an indicator of changes in profitability and operational performance. Within the NSE mid-cap segment, eight stocks reported EBITDA growth of more than 80% in the June 2026 quarter compared with the same period last year (excluding banking and financial stocks), according to StockEdge profitability data.
